Ramadan begins today

THE holy month of Ramadan begins today, and Muslims in the country and worldwide are expected to begin the month of fasting. During the sacred month, Muslims perform the act of fasting by keeping away from food, drink, marital relations and all forms of wrongdoing from dawn to sunset each day.
The month ends with the celebration of Eid-ul-Fitr which is expected to fall on August 31.
Yesterday, the Central Islamic Organisation of Guyana (CIOG) said it wishes to inform all Muslims that the crescent for Ramadan has been sighted.

Taraweeh prayers commenced last evening and fasting  begins today.

CIOG also extended Ramadan Greetings to all Muslims.
